Accessory Installation Guide
2023MY Solterra – Activity Mount | PT97442231 |
IN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S
PART NUMBER: PT97442231
DESCRIPTION: Activity Mount
KIT CONTENTS:
Activity Mount
Driver Side Plate
Passenger Side Plate
Blocker Plate (2)
Hardware Kit
– 8 M12-1.25 x 35 Hex Bolt
– 8 M12 Conical Toothed Washer
– 1 U Shaped Edging
Customer Care Card
TOOLS REQUIRED:
Cut Resistant Gloves
Flat Blade Screw Driver
Torque Wrench- 0-100 lbf-ft
Tin Snips- For cutting bumper
3/8” drive socket wrench-14mm
3/8” drive socket – 19mm
¼” drive socket
19mm end wrench
1. Preparation
(a) Wear safety glasses
(b) Verify the kit contents.
(c) Lift Vehicle to comfortable working height
(d) Disconnect Battery
2. Remove Rear Bumper Side Seal LH/RH
(a) Remove 2 push pins & 1 bolt (Fig. 2-1)
(b) Repeat on RH
(c) Add tape to lower bumper before wheel arch removal for protection.
3. Remove Rear Wheel Arch Molding LH/RH
(a) Open Rear Door
(b) Remove 10mm screw and 2 push pins and plastic Nut from LH sides (Fig. 3-1)
Note** When removing lower tabs may damage paint on vehicle
Note** First and last clip do not have gasket.
(c) Disengage clips by pulling in direction of arrow (Fig. 3-2)
(d) Repeat on RH side
4. Remove Rear Combination Light Cover LH/RH
(a) Disengage the claws to remove LH cover (Fig. 4-1)
(b) Repeat on RH side
5. Remove the Rear Bumper Assembly
(a) Remove tow hook and discard.
(b) Remove 2 upper push pins (1 on LH, 1 on RH side). (Fig. 5-1).
(c) Remove 4 screws (2 on LH, 2 on RH side) in middle and lower locations. (Fig. 5-1).
(d) Remove 2 push pins (1 on LH, 1 on RH side) as show in red. (Fig. 5-2).
(e) Remove 6 push pins from underneath vehicle (Fig. 5-2)
(f) Disengage clips by gently pulling in direction of arrow (Fig. 5-3).
(g) Then gently pull bumper to disengage claws
(h)Before complete removing bumper disconnect the wire harness for parking support brake system. (Fig. 5-3)
(i) Place removed bumper on protective cloth to avoid scratches
6. Remove Bumper Beam Assembly and discard
(a) Remove (6) 14mm bolts from the bumper bar Remove and discard bumper beam. (Fig. 6-1).
7. Remove Bumper Beam Supports LH/RH
(a) Once Bumper Beam is removed, remove 10 14mm Bolts (5 on LH, 5 on RH) from the bumper beam supports that sit behind the bumper beam. Then fully remove and discard the LH and RH Bumper Beam Brackets. (Fig. 7-1)
(b) Be sure to keep the bolts removed in this step for installation of the blocker plates.
(c) Bumper Beam and Support Disassembly should look like (Figure 7-2).
8. Remove Under Covers
(a) Using a flat head driver remove 6 plastic push pins on larger under body (2 Pieces). (Fig 8-1)
(b) Using a flat head driver remove 2 plastic nuts on smaller under body (2 Pieces), push in and unscrew. (Fig 8-1)
9. Removal of Tape Plugs
(a) Remove 4 tape plugs (2 on LH and 2 on RH)
on side surfaces outboard. (Fig 9-1)
10. Install Side Plates
(a) Insert side plates LH and RH brackets into
the side frames. (Fig.10-1)
(b) Hand tighten the M12 bolts so the brackets are flush to the frame rail. Figure 10-2.
11. Install the closeout plates LH/RH
(a) Using the (10) 14mm bolts, removed from the bumper beam support in step 7, install the LH and RH close out plates. (Fig. 11-1)
(b) Torque the bolts to 18 Nm (13 ft-lbs).
12. Install Hitch
(a) Lift tow hitch into position in between the two frame brackets. Visually align the holes with the holes in the
brackets.
(b) Install (2) 14mm bolts through the framebrackets into the hitch bracket weld nuts on both
the LH and RH sides (Fig. 12-1).
(c) Torque each 14mm bolt to 100Nm (74 ft-lbs) ( including side plate 19mm bolts on step 10).
(c) See Torque Sequence in Fig 12-2.
13. Trim Bumper
(a) Protect the A surface of the bumper by placing a soft rag between hard surface where A surface of bumper will lay for trimming.
(b) With the A surface facing down locate the B surface location where the trimming will occur
(c) Using the template locate the two datum points and align the template to the two datums.
(d) Trace cut out area (in yellow) using template (Fig 13-1)
(e) Using tin snips cut to cut into the plastic
14. Assembly Weather Strip
(a) Apply weather strip starting from the back edge of the cut out.
(b) Slowly, Apply even pressure all the way around the edge trim.
(c) Visually confirm that weather strip has been fully seated.
(d) Cut any excess trip off back of weatherstrip. ( Fig 14-1)
15. Reinstall Undercovers
(a) Reinstall all 4 undercovers.
(1) Install the 2 smaller pieces first
(2) Install Large Passenger Undercover
(3) Install Larger Driver Side Undercover
16. Reinstall Rear Bumper Assembly
(a) Reconnect the wire harness for parking brake support system. (Fig 16-1)
(b) Conduct push/pull check on connector to ensure connector is seated.
(c) Re-engage all clips by pushing forward bumper assembly. (Fig 16-1)
(d) Reinstalled 4 screws (2 on LH, 2 on RH side) in middle and lower locations. (Fig. 16-1)
(e ) Reinstall 2 upper push pins (1 on LH, 1 on RH side). (Fig. 16-1) (Re-engage clips on side of bumper by pushing in
direction of arrow. (Fig.16-2)
(f) Reinstall 2 push pins (1 on LH, 1 on RH side) as show in red. (Fig. 16-2)
(g) Reinstall 6 push pins from underneath vehicle. (Fig. 16-3)
17. Reinstall Rear Combination Light Cover LH/RH
(a) Reinstall 3 push pins (Fig 17-1)(Fig. 17-1)
(b) Repeat on RH side
18. Reinstalled Rear Bumper Side Seal LH/RH
(a) Re-engage LH side clips by pushing in direction of arrow (Fig. 18-1)
(a) (b) Reinstall screw and 3 push pins from LH side (Fig. 18-2)
19. Reinstall Rear Wheel Arch Moulding LH/RH
(a) Re-engage the claws to install LH cover.(Fig.19-1)
(b) Repeat on RH side
20. Care Card Placement
(a) Locate care card provided in package
(b) Place care card in center console
21. Complete the installation.
(a) Remove vehicle protection.
